Nepal, Bangladesh and South Asia | Idea of Nepal with Nilanthi Samaranayake
Biswas Baral interviews Nilanthi Samaranayake, a Visiting Expert at the US Institute of Peace.bookmark

She is also an Adjunct Fellow at the East-West Center in Washington DC. Samaranayake specialises in the analysis of Indian Ocean security, small states’ navigation of great power competition, and the relations of smaller South Asian countries with China, India, and the US.
In this conversation, Samaranayake talks about, among other things, the similarities and differences of the ground realities in Nepal and Bangladesh, the relations of smaller South Asian states with big powers, how Nepal’s internal politics appears from the outside, the Indo-Pacific Strategy, the Belt and Road Initiative, and Nepal’s handling of the competing influences of India, China and the US.
